The rental market in Dubai is expanding because prices for real estate categories keep rising steadily. The residential areas of Dubai Marina, Business Bay and Downtown Dubai draw high levels of interest from expatriate workers and local professionals who want upscale homes.
Real estate investments in Dubai produce rental income that ranges from 5% to 8% per year, which exceeds rental returns commonly observed in worldwide real estate markets. Vacation home investments find Dubai an attractive market because of its growing number of short-term rentals and properties suitable for Airbnb operations in tourist areas.

The luxury housing market continues to thrive despite middle-income property seekers finding it more difficult to afford property purchases because of increasing prices. Homeownership has become more achievable to Dubai residents through off-plan projects with extended payment plans.
The current global economic changes may influence how much homeowners pay for their mortgages. A rise in interest rates tends to reduce property deals and enables cash buyers and investors to control an expanded segment of the market.
The market demand for luxury properties continues, but some Dubai neighborhoods now have excessive quantities of mid-range apartments. High-demand areas with distinctive real estate properties should be investor targets to maximise both market value appreciation and rental income.
Buyers who purchase off-plan developments can obtain properties at lower prices through adaptable payment structures. The greatest off-plan projects exist within Dubai Creek Harbour, Jumeirah Village Circle and Emaar Beachfront.
Property values keep rising steadily within prime real estate regions that offer luxury living. Branded residences and ultra-luxury penthouses provide investors robust appreciation potential and high rental returns.
Tourism activity in Dubai continues to grow strongly, which creates profitable rental opportunities for investors. Properties located in Downtown Dubai, Dubai Marina and Palm Jumeirah suit well for short-term rentals.
Dubai has established itself as an international business center which drives investor interest toward commercial properties and data centers. Office spaces, retail facilities and advanced tech-based infrastructure demonstrate increasing market demand that leads to stable returns.
